Peñalosa to grace Liloan boxing tonite Event open to the public for free

Reigning WBO bantamweight champion Gerry “Fearless” Peñalosa will once again visit the Queen City of the South to grace tonight’s “Rambulan sa Liloan” boxing show topbilled by his prized ward Michael Fareñas (21-2-2, 18KOs) at the Panphil B. Frasco Memorial Sports Complex in Liloan, Cebu.

The 24-year-old Fareñas, who is now based in Foothill Ranch in California, United States, will trade mitss with Thai featherweight prospect Boonmee Sithsrivinitwit-thayakom. Though no title is at stake, the match is of paramount importance for Fareñas as this will be his ticket to a bigger, more lucrative ring sortie ahead.

“Gerry Peñalosa is coming over to personally lend moral support to his boxer (Fareñas). His presence will surely inspire Fareñas to put up an impressive performance,” said event matchmaker Willie Flores. Peñalosa was here in Cebu last Saturday, adding glitz and glamour to the blockbuster “Laban na Banal” card at the Cebu Coliseum.

Peñalosa (53-6-2, 36KOs) is slated to defend his WBO throne against the dangerous Mexican challenger Nestor Rocha (19-1, 6KOs) on September 20 at the Mindanao Civic Center in Tubod, Lanao del Norte. It will be his second defense of the crown he seized via a spectacular seventh round stoppage of erstwhile titlist Jhonny Gonzalez in the Boxing World Cup on August 2 last year at the Arco Arena in Sacramento, California.

If victorious, Fareñas will be inserted in the undercard of the Peñalosa-Rocha rumble against Hussein Pazzi (17-8-1, 7KOs) of Tanzania for the interim WBO Oriental featherweight championship.

In the equally-exciting supporting bouts, former PABA light flyweight champion Marvin “Leyte Bomber” Tampus will square off against Jonrey Verano of Valencia, Bukidnon, while Jonathan Baat of Cebu will take on Daniel Diolan of Zamboanga.

The preliminaries feature Rodulfo Sumabong  vs. Renan Branzuela, Jason Siaton vs. Elmar Francisco, Adonis Aguello vs. Randy Megriños, Jaime Bermisdo vs. Andy Seneres, Jherpaul Valero vs. Christian Dave Baliguat, and Ponce de Leon vs. Aljered Tuñacao.

The slambang show presented by MP Promotions of Filipino ring superstar Manny Pacquiao in partnership with RWS Promotions International and Liloan Mayor Vincent Franco “Duke” Frasco is the first pro boxing card in three years in the bustling municipality famous for its mouth-watering delicacies rosquillos and otap. The last was on June 12, 2005 when Wyndel “Braveheart” Janiola stopped Ricky Escaner in 1:33 of the second round. — EBV
